15 hours ago, nikhils said:
C:\Windows\System32\drivers\mbae64.sys
C:\Windows\System32\drivers\mbam.sys
C:\Windows\System32\drivers\MBAMChameleon.sys
C:\Windows\System32\drivers\MBAMSwissArmy.sys
C:\Windows\System32\drivers\mwac.sys
C:\Windows\system32\Drivers\farflt.sysAlso please exclude the following folders too: (The complete folder)
C:\Program Files\Malwarebytes\Anti-Malware
C:\ProgramData\Malwarebytes\MBAMServiceThis list should be part of the FAQ section for Malwarebytes 3 (What to exclude in third-party anti-malware apps, or something along those lines).
